real after tax return as starting point. add inflation to get the nominal after tax return. divide that by 1-t to get the before tax nominal before tax return. this to me makes the most sense as you would be taxed on the nominal return (which is what is implied if you work the above backwards starting with before tax nominal return.作者: torontoanalyst 时间: 2011-7-16 07:20
